Just make sure you have a dry road, as she WILL be a beast

By the way, UNLESS you have them turn off the Torque limiters in the tranny, sometimes the tranny will go into limp mode when it sees TOO much torque.
Think 40 degree dry day here, as it just happened last Saturday to me on the way home form Summit racing.
This is NORMAL and occurs with ALL 600 tunes as I have checked this with some of the fastest guys on this board.
I like to think of it as a safety fuse. AKA Better to turn the car on and off again, rather than replacing a tranny or rear end, LOL
